There is a total reset procedure for the Denon in the manual.

Hard power cycle (NOT just a standby cycle) while pressing the TWO TOPmost, LEFTmost buttons in the main button array (i.e. NOT the smaller groups of buttons sometimes seen on the unit's face). Works for all Denon AVRs AFAIK. All display elements and indicator lights will blink about once a second. Check carefully to make sure all elements/LEDs are good, then release buttons and unit should boot directly to stereo FM Preset A 87.5MHz at minimum volume (less than -80dB).
